In last week’s report, we introduced the Oppenheimer US Revenue Model. This Model is designed to provide overweight exposure to the strongest fund within an inventory of four members of Oppenheimer’s Revenue line-up.  With the most recent evaluation at the start of April, the Model is currently overweighted to the Oppenheimer Small Cap Revenue ETF RWJ, as it resides at the top of the Model’s Relative Strength Matrix.  With that in mind, this week we would like to take a closer look at the RWJ. 

The Oppenheimer Small Cap Revenue ETF seeks to provide broad exposure to the S&P 600 universe, but does so by weighting the holdings by top line revenue, instead of market capitalization.  As a result, weightings among the broad sectors differ from that of the S&P 600 Index SML, with the most significant difference being the Fund’s allocation to the Consumer Discretionary sector, a top ranked sector within our Dynamic Asset Level Investing (DALI) tool.  The Fund currently has an allocation of almost 28% to that sector, compared to the SML’s allocation of roughly 16%.     

From a technical perspective, the RWJ has a fund score of 3.40 which is slightly above the average score for funds within the Small Cap Value category.  It is currently trading in an overall positive trend, and after hitting an all-time high in January at $73, the Fund’s trading has consolidated between $65 and $71. For those following the Fund outside of the Oppenheimer US Revenue Model, a move to $64 would violate near term support while it would take a move to $58 from here in order to violate the bullish support line, which would change the overall trend of this fund to negative.
